许多网页开发人员都熟悉并喜欢使用jQuery获取鼠标滑出事件来执行各种交互动作。jQuery是一个流行的JavaScript库,为处理DOM元素和事件提供了简洁易用的方法,使网页开发变得更加便捷和高效。
jQuery获取鼠标滑出事件
在网页中,处理用户鼠标滑出事件是非常常见的需求。通过jQuery,我们可以轻松地实现对元素鼠标滑出的监测和相应操作。下面是一个简单的示例代码:
<!DOCTYPE html> <html> <head> <script src="jquery-3.6.0.min.js"></script> </head> <body> <div id="element">鼠标滑出我试试</div> <script> $(document).ready(function(){ $("#element").mouseleave(function(){ alert("鼠标滑出了!"); }); }); </script> </body> </html>在上面的代码中,我们首先引入了jQuery库,然后在文档准备就绪后,通过选择器选取需要监测的元素,并使用mouseleave()方法来定义鼠标滑出时的行为。
- 通过mouseenter()方法来实现鼠标滑入的检测。
- 通过hover()方法来同时监听鼠标滑入和滑出事件。
- 通过mouseover()方法来实现类似鼠标进入的效果。
jQuery获取元素坐标
除了鼠标滑出事件,获取元素坐标也是网页开发中常见的操作。通过jQuery,我们可以轻松获取元素的位置信息,以便进行定位或处理。
下面是一个简单的示例,演示了如何使用offset()方法获取元素相对于文档的位置坐标:
<!DOCTYPE html> <html> <head> <script src="jquery-3.6.0.min.js"></script> </head> <body> <div id="element" style="position: absolute; top: 100px; left: 200px;">这是一个元素</div> <script> $(document).ready(function(){ var offset = $("#element").offset(); alert("元素相对文档的位置:左侧 " + offset.left + "像素, 顶部 " + offset.top + "像素"); }); </script> </body> </html>
在上述代码中,我们设置了一个绝对定位的元素,并使用offset()方法获取了该元素相对于文档的位置坐标,从而可以动态获取其准确位置信息。
结语
通过简单的示例,我们了解了如何使用jQuery来获取鼠标滑出事件和元素坐标信息。jQuery的强大功能和简洁语法使其成为许多开发人员的首选工具之一。希望本文能帮助您更好地理解和运用jQuery处理相关事件和操作。
- 相关评论
- 我要评论
-